    Hello,

    to get ride of the search bar in every page is quite easy. just open file /views/artists/tmpl/default_letterbar.php
    you just need to remove the piece that says:

    <?php if(!$big_bar){ ?>
    <div class='col-md-3 searchbox-container-small'>
    <?php
    include(JPATH_SITE.DS.'components'.DS.'com_muscol'.DS.'views'.DS.'artists'.DS.'tmpl'.DS.'default_searchbar.php'); ?>
    </div>
    <?php } ?>
